Steam Top Sellers – Week Ending 25 September

This week’s Steam Top Sellers shows a rise to the top for GTA 5 thanks to a sale but there are some new entries.

Recommended Videos

Stunlock Studio will be particularly pleased that the Battlerite Early Access (see preview) is going particularly well with the game jumping straight into the second spot. The return of GSC Gameworld to the Cossacks RTS series takes Cossacks 3 number five while also occupying the eighth spot.

The other new entry is 2K’s NBA 2K17 and Divinity Origin Sin 2 Early Access (see preview) is holding its own in fourth.
